Should Juvenile Delinquency Be Abolished?
McCarthy, Francis Barry
Crime and Delinquency, 23, 2, 196-203, Apr 77
The legal concept of juvenile delinquency as administered for the last 150 years began to die with the Gault decision. Delinquency jurisdiction should be removed from juvenile courts and be allowed to revert to criminal courts, where interests which are highly valued in our society can be protected more fully.
